How they compare
Bermuda currently reports 11 ltpureal against 10.93 ltpureal in Martinique, a difference of 0.07 ltpureal.
Across all 25 years both countries report, Bermuda has been ahead every year.
Bermuda ranks 29th and Martinique ranks 31st of 224 countries.
Bermuda has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bermuda | Martinique |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 13.06 ltpureal | 10.34 ltpureal | 2.72 ltpureal | Bermuda |
| 2010s | 12.01 ltpureal | 9.89 ltpureal | 2.12 ltpureal | Bermuda |
| 2020s | 11.14 ltpureal | 10.51 ltpureal | 0.6271 ltpureal | Bermuda |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
